C# Класс Microsoft.Protocols.TestTools.StackSdk.RemoteDesktop.Rdpeudp.RdpeudpSocket

Наследование: IDisposable

Открытые методы

Метод Описание
Close ( ) : void

Close connection of this socket

CreateAckVectorHeader ( ) : RDPUDP_ACK_VECTOR_HEADER

Create RDPUDP_ACK_VECTOR_HEADER Structure for packet sending

CreateFECPayload ( RdpeudpPacket sourcePackets, byte &uFecIndex ) : byte[]
CreateFECPayloadHeader ( uint snSourceStart, byte uSourceRange, byte uFecIndex ) : RDPUDP_FEC_PAYLOAD_HEADER

Create RDPUDP_FEC_PAYLOAD_HEADER Structure

CreateSourcePacket ( byte data ) : RdpeudpPacket

Create Source Packet from byte data

CreateSourcePayloadHeader ( ) : RDPUDP_SOURCE_PAYLOAD_HEADER

Create a RDPUDP_SOURCE_PAYLOAD_HEADER Structure

CreateSynData ( uint initialSequenceNumber = null ) : RDPUDP_SYNDATA_PAYLOAD

Create RDPUDP_SYNDATA_PAYLOAD Structure

CreateSynExData ( uUdpVer_Values version ) : RDPUDP_SYNDATAEX_PAYLOAD

Create RDPUDP_SYNDATAEX_PAYLOAD Structure

Dispose ( ) : void

Dispose this socket

ExpectACKPacket ( System.TimeSpan timeout ) : RdpeudpPacket

Expect an ACK packet

ExpectPacket ( System.TimeSpan timeout ) : RdpeudpPacket
FECRecover ( RdpeudpPacket sourcePackets, byte uFecIndex, byte fecData, uint targetIndex ) : byte[]
MarkSourcePacketReceived ( uint snSourceStart ) : void

Set a source packet have been received This method is only used when autohandle is false, this can make sure create correct Ack header when autohandle is false

ProcessAckOfAckVectorHeader ( RdpeudpPacket eudpPacket ) : void

Process RDPUDP_ACK_OF_ACKVECTOR_HEADER Structure if the packet have

ProcessFECPayloadData ( RdpeudpPacket eudpPacket ) : void

Process RDPUDP_FEC_PAYLOAD_HEADER Structure and FEC Payload

ProcessSourceData ( RdpeudpPacket eudpPacket ) : void

Process Source payload if the packet has source payload data

ProcessSynDataExPayload ( RdpeudpPacket eudpPacket ) : void

The highest version supported by both endpoints, which is RDPUDP_PROTOCOL_VERSION_1 if either this packet or the SYN packet does not specify a version, is the version that MUST be used by both endpoints.

ProcessSynPacket ( RdpeudpPacket eudpPacket ) : void

Process a Syn Packet

RdpeudpSocket ( TransportMode mode, IPEndPoint remoteEp, bool autohandle, RdpeudpSocketSender sender ) : System

Constructor.

ReceivePacket ( RdpeudpPacket eudpPacket ) : void

Method used to process a received packet

ReceivePacket ( StackPacket packet ) : void

Method used to process a received packet

RetransmitPacket ( RdpeudpPacket packet ) : bool
Send ( byte data ) : bool

Send Data from this specified UDP transport

SendAcKPacket ( bool delayACK = false ) : bool

Send an ACK Datagrams

SendBytesByUDP ( byte data ) : void

Send bytes via UDP transport

SendPacket ( RdpeudpPacket packet ) : bool

Send a RDPEUDP Packet
